In India, flue-cured Virginia tobacco (FCV) is cultivated in about 2 lakh ha contributing Rs 8,000 crores to central excise and Rs 1,000 crores to the foreign exchange. Among the different zones of FCV tobacco production, Khammam district of Andhra Pradesh occupies the place of prominence with 5,000 ha of area under the crop, producing annually about 5.0 million kg leaf.
